Welcome to Active Gloucestershire.

Active Gloucestershire is an independent charity with a vision for everyone in Gloucestershire to be active everyday. 

We have a key responsibility for increasing physical activity levels across Gloucestershire and are an agent of change, uniting individuals and a huge range of national policy makers and organisations around one of the greatest challenges facing our society today: inactivity. 

We want to inspire, connect and enable people in Gloucestershire to get active in a way that works for them, and we want to support those who can help others move more, like activity providers, sports clubs and key partners in the county. We do this through we can move – Gloucestershire’s social movement that brings people together from across the sports and physical activity sector, public sector of voluntary and community sector. 

We all work together to help people benefit from a more active lifestyle. 

 

We can move

Co-ordinated by Active Gloucestershire, we can move is a social movement designed to get more people active in the county.
